Steps to create the crash:
1. Sorted 'All' applications by popularity, highest to lowest
2. Select Thunderbird for installation
3. Select Java Web Start for installation. Prompts that Java JRE is also needed; accepted.
4. Changed to 'Sound and Video'
5. Crash occurred
Running 9.04-beta1 with all updates as of this moment.
